All of them were 25 or under, and I still marvel at just how young they were to make such an iconic album. Slash and Steven were only 20 years old when they joined the band, and Slash hadn't even turned 22 yet when Appetite came out.

You do wonder if some of the problems the guys had down the line were in some way related to the fact that their career peaked you could say at an age most kids are just getting out of college.

They've all had success since then, but I have thought to myself before like if you were them, where do you really go from there when on your first try you write what is considered by some to be the greatest rock album of all time?
